20 MCW-bodied Daimler Fleetlines took place on Friday; 10 have detachable tops and 10 fixed. These are the first Daimlers that the town has ever ordered. Seen here at the ceremony are, left to right: Gk. A. W. Patton, transport committee chairman; Aid. R. S. Morris, Mayor of Bournemouth: Mr. A. Whittaker, deputy chairman of Transport Vehicles (Daimler) Ltd.; and Mr. W. H. Lawrence, sales director of MetropolitanCammell-Weymann Ltd. Mr. Lawrence gave an assurance that he would do all he could to see that Bournemouth's vehicle orders were not affected by the closing of the Add/es/one works. (See also page 51.)
